directions

  • Candy the walnuts:

  • Toast the walnuts in an iron pan, add the honey and mix until sticky. Turn off the heat, and mix in the flax seeds. Set candied walnuts aside to cool.
  • Make the brussel sprouts:

  • Put oil in a large, flat-bottom pan. When the oil is hot, put the onions in and cook them until they're soft.
  • Add the brussel sprouts, and toss. Add the paprika, Mexican chocolate, toss and put the lid on. Add a little water (1/2 cup) if brussel sprouts aren't making enough steam. Salt to taste.
  • Toss walnuts with brussel sprouts.
